And this weekend was the annual Bat Fest 2007 at Congress bridge. For those of you that don't know the Congress Avenue Bridge spans Town Lake in downtown Austin and is home to the largest urban bat colony in North America. The colony is estimated at 1.5 million Mexican free-tail bats. Each night from mid-March to November, the bats emerge from under the bridge at dusk to blanket the sky as they head out to forage for food. This event has become one of the most spectacular and unusual tourist attractions in Texas. Unfortunately Stephen had to work all weekend, so we missed it.
